  • Both you and your fiancé should learn to tape an ankle properly. Also, ice your ankle 2-3 times a day, keep it elevated most of the time, take ibuprofen for pain/keeping the swelling down...

    Ankle injuries take a while to heal. Having a doctor on hand is not a bad idea though...
